NEW MEXICO:

Middle distance specialist who is the Lobos' top returnee and an MWC Outdoor Championship finalist in the 800...has redshirt seasons available in cross country and indoor and outdoor track...

2008: (cross country) Appeared in the first two meets of the year...25th at the Lobo Invitational and 21st at NMSU...

2007-08: (outdoor) Led the team (20th MWC) in the 800 with a career-best time of 2:16.90...time was recorded in an 8th place finish in the MWC prelims...finished 9th in the 800 finals...No. 3 on the team in the 1,500 with a top time of 4:50.46...8 races with a top finish of 3rd in the 800 at Cal...Academic All-MWC... (indoor) Ranked 2nd on the team in the 800 (2:28.34) and No. 4 in the mile (5:35.14)...3 races...

2006-07: (outdoor) Ranked 2nd on the team in the 800 (2:18.51)...raced 5 times in 4 meets...Academic all-MWC... (indoor) Raced 7 times in 5 meets in the mile and 800...helped the DMR team finish 6th at the conference meet... (cross country) Ran in two meets...finished 4th on the team (24th overall) at New Mexico State...

HIGH SCHOOL:

A 2006 graduate of Albuquerque Eldorado High School...four-year letterwinner in track and cross country for coaches Kathy Brion and Jimmy Butler...was one of the top cross country runners in the state as a freshman, placing fifth at the 5A state meet and 2nd at the city championships behind current UNM teammate Leslie Luna...finished fifth in the 800 as a sophomore and freshman at the state track meet...district 400m champion in 2003 and `06....

PERSONAL:

Born in Albuquerque, N.M...full name is Lynn Marie Brasher...daughter of Carl and Lucille Brasher...comes from a strong sports family...mom ran track at UNM (1976-77), uncle Perkins Brasher competed at New Mexico JC (1969-70), and aunt Rosie Jones has been on the LPGA tour since 1981...second cousin Lynn Brasher also ran track for the Lobos (1979-80), earning All-America honors in 1979 as part of the UNM two-mile relay team...has a younger sister, Julie...major is Film & Digital Media.
